Elon Musk, CEO of Tesla, SpaceX, and X Corp, has become a notable figure in U.S. political discussions, ahead of the 2024 election. Musk, who once identified as politically moderate and has supported both Democrats and Republicans in past elections, has recently shown a shift towards conservative views. 

Musk publicly endorsed Donald Trump and has been campaigning for the Republican presidential nominee. He has also donated $132million to elect Trump and he has been promised a cabinet position by Trump if he comes to power.

Known for his controversial stances, he has been critical of Biden government;s stand on immigration, carbon taxes, and voices concerns over topics like AI, climate change, and population decline. His political impact has extended internationally, with high-profile opinions on issues like the Russia-Ukraine conflict and U.S.-China relations.
